I agree with these recommendations. If you want Canon, it depends on the size and use:

Best ultra-compact - S90

Best compact - G11

Best super zoom - SX20 IS

Best rugged camera - D-10

For a compact camera , low light photography is as good as it gets, really. Like I said, S90 is THE best ultra-compact camera at the moment (at least in my opinion).

Ability to shoot RAW allows you a lot to work with when it comes to noise.
